Thomas Cook Group plc is one of the world’s leading leisure travel groups with sales of £7.8 billion in the year ended 30 September 2015. Thomas Cook is supported by 21,813 employees and operates from 15 source markets; it is number one or two (by revenue) in all its core markets. Thomas Cook Group plc’s shares are listed on the London Stock Exchange (TCG).
